Two new cargo carriers, Cargo 360 and Shanghai Airlines, have scheduled service at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port.
Cargo 360 Inc. initiated cargo service between Seoul, Korea and New York via Anchorage. Cargo 360 is a new U.S. cargo carrier based in Seattle. The new cargo airline landed its first flight in Anchorage recently using a Boeing 747. The eight weekly cargo flights are being operated exclusively for Korean Air Cargo.
Shanghai Airlines Co. Ltd. initiated six weekly cargo flights between Shanghai and Los Angeles via Anchorage in July. Shanghai Airlines will be utilizing the landing rights made available by the 2004 U.S.-China aviation agreement.
Shanghai Airlines executives flew to Beijing recently to meet with ANC Marketing Director Linda Close to finalize the requirements for their entrance into the Anchorage market. Shanghai also had a team in Anchorage recently to finalize operational details.
